Nonbuild-related files from model's build information
files=getNonBuildFiles(buildinfo, concatenatePaths, replaceMatlabroot, includeGroups, excludeGroups)
includeGroups and excludeGroups are optional.
Build information returned by RTW.BuildInfo.
The logical value true or false.
| If You Specify... | The Function... |
|---|---|
| true | Concatenates and returns each filename with its corresponding path. |
| false | Returns only filenames. |
The logical value true or false.
| If You Specify... | The Function... |
|---|---|
| true | Replaces the token $(MATLAB_ROOT) with the absolute path string for your MATLAB® installation directory. |
| false | Does not replace the token $(MATLAB_ROOT). |
A character array or cell array of character arrays that specifies groups of nonbuild files you want the function to return.
A character array or cell array of character arrays that specifies groups of nonbuild files you do not want the function to return.
Names of nonbuild files stored in the model's build information.
The getNonBuildFiles function returns the names of nonbuild-related files, such as DLL files required for a final executable, or a README file, stored in the model's build information. Use the concatenatePaths and replaceMatlabroot arguments to control whether the function includes paths and your MATLAB root definition in the output it returns. Using optional includeGroups and excludeGroups arguments, you can selectively include or exclude groups of nonbuild files the function returns.
If you choose to specify excludeGroups and omit includeGroups, specify a null string ('') for includeGroups.
Get all nonbuild filenames stored in build information myModelBuildInfo.
myModelBuildInfo = RTW.BuildInfo;
addNonBuildFiles(myModelBuildInfo, {'readme.txt' 'myutility1.dll'...
'myutility2.dll'});
nonbuildfiles=getNonBuildFiles(myModelBuildInfo, false, false);
nonbuildfiles
nonbuildfiles =
